**Vendor note: Inkmill markdown pipeline**

Rendering for Parchway docs is outsourced to Inkmill under an annual contract, renewing each March. They handle sanitization and PDF export; we own the upload queue. SLA: 4-hour response on rendering failures. Escalate only after two failed retries. Their support desk is reachable at the address below.

billing contact of hahaf-baguf = zorael.tammir.jorius@sivrelhq.internal

## Deploying the Gatewick Proctor Queue

Deploys are pretty painless: push to main, wait for the pipeline, then watch the queue drain dashboard for five minutes. If candidates pile up mid-exam, roll back first and ask questions later — the queue replays safely. Everything the workers care about lives in one config block, shown here for reference.

settings of bafof-yagef:
JOROX_PIN=8740
JOROX_TENANT=pelox
JOROX_METRICS_HOST=metrics.jorox.qorvelworks.internal
JOROX_SEAL=seal_c78f63c1
JOROX_STANDBY_TEAM=norax

### Log sampling — Brindleworth ingest service

The Brindleworth ingest service emits roughly 40k log lines per minute, so we sample aggressively: 1% of INFO, 100% of WARN and above. Do not raise the INFO rate in production without approval from the observability rotation, as storage costs scale sharply. Sampling rates, override procedure, and the approval form are all kept on the internal page.

runbook for tafof-yawif: https://confluence.tolvaqsys.internal/display/display/browse/pages/7be3

## Changelog — Font vendoring defaults changed

As of this release, the Bracken UI build no longer fetches third-party fonts at build time. All typefaces used by the Lanternwell suite are now vendored into the repo under a dedicated assets directory, and the fetch step is skipped by default. If you're onboarding, nothing to install — the fonts travel with the checkout. The build flags controlling this behavior are listed below.

settings of hadup-yafog:
LAMAEL_PIN=3761
LAMAEL_TENANT=istmir
LAMAEL_METRICS_HOST=metrics.lamael.plorvasys.test
LAMAEL_SEAL=seal_8ea68500
LAMAEL_STANDBY_TEAM=fraok